Re: I wish someone would have told me...
The code sets when the O2 sensor voltage falls beow 200mV and stays there. Could be a faulty sensor, or something like an exhaust leak pouring air into the exhaust. Swap the pre-cat O2 sensors side to side. If the problem follows the sensor (P0151 changes to P0131) its definitely a sensor problem. If the code stays on the passenger side, its not the sensor, its something external causing the sensor to read low.
